FNDA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2019 in Review

151 of the 4,560 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Schwab Fundamental US Small Company Index ETF (FNDA) for Q3 2019, worth a combined $2.73B — up 6% from $2.58B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 18 funds opened new FNDA positions and 16 closed out — a net gain of 2 holders — while 67 added to existing stakes and 35 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Charles Schwab Investment Advisory, adding an estimated $113M. The largest seller was Strategic Advisors, cutting an estimated $2.3M.
